Troubleshooting Common Issues in Sheet Metal Laser Cutting Laser engraving of sheet fabrication can encounter several challenges that impact part quality. Common errors frequently arise from material inconsistencies, equipment settings, or head issues. Incorrect focus settings can cause in irregular edge shapes. slag formation suggests insufficient energy or air flow. Stock thickness changes may require adjustments to severing velocity and power. Furthermore, a contaminated nozzle can change the slice quality; regular cleaning is essential. To guarantee consistent results, a complete assessment of laser parameters and material properties is needed. Confirm focus parameters. Review beam condition and remove debris. Adjust power and pressure. Assess sheet thickness variations. Review manufacturer's instructions.
